Montjoire is a commune located in the Haute-Garonne department in the Occitanie region of France. Its geographical coordinates are 43.76899 latitude and 1.53362 longitude, placing it in the southwestern part of the country. The city is situated approximately 20 kilometers east of Toulouse, a significant urban center in the region.
Montjoire is known for its picturesque rural landscape, making it a quiet residential area that attracts those looking for a peaceful lifestyle while being close to urban amenities. The timezone for Montjoire is Europe/Paris, aligning it with the central European time zone, which is UTC+1, and UTC+2 during daylight saving time. Timezone in Montjoire
Montjoire is located in the Europe/Paris timezone, which operates under a UTC offset of +1 hour during standard time. This means that when it is noon in Coordinated Universal Time (UTC), it is 1 PM in Montjoire. However, the region observes daylight saving time, shifting the clock forward by one hour to UTC +2 during the summer months, typically from the last Sunday in March to the last Sunday in October.
In comparison to the United States, Montjoire’s time zone is ahead of Eastern Standard Time by six hours and ahead of Pacific Standard Time by nine hours. Practical Information for Visitors
Montjoire is a charming village located near Toulouse in the Occitanie region of France. The nearest airport is Toulouse-Blagnac Airport, which is about 30 kilometers away, providing domestic and international flights. From the airport, you can rent a car or take a shuttle to reach Montjoire.
If traveling by train, the nearest major station is in Toulouse, where you can catch a local bus or taxi to the village. The climate in Montjoire is typical of the Mediterranean, featuring hot summers and mild winters. The best time to visit is during the spring (April to June) and early autumn (September to October) when the weather is pleasant and ideal for outdoor activities.
Summer can be quite warm, with temperatures often exceeding 30 degrees Celsius. When visiting, it’s advisable to wear comfortable shoes for exploring the village and its surrounding countryside. French is the primary language spoken, so knowing a few basic phrases can enhance your experience.
